Transaction faf71a5c9a4638258f91158d9264b6bb65704699fc0ab2ae93701e4369ba3d04
1 Input
2 Outputs
- faf71a5c9a4638258f91158d9264b6bb65704699fc0ab2ae93701e4369ba3d04:0
- faf71a5c9a4638258f91158d9264b6bb65704699fc0ab2ae93701e4369ba3d04:1
value 900000
address 33dRe3GH1y1vZUa3374SvKP9AV69wdVX5d
value 3788248240
address 16XCGWWgyuT4AVQGZ3Jam7EmSsoBWyb3FW